Ethnic Link Services
Ethnic Link Services (ELS) is a statewide service for frail older people and their carers from culturally and linguistically diverse (CALD) backgrounds to maintain their independence and to support them living at home in their communities. ELS uses bilingual, bicultural staff to provide language and support services for clients. ELS also facilitates social support groups for various CALD communities across South Australia. New languages are added as required.
Mercy Services
The Social Support Service has caring volunteers who can assist you with the following:
- Home visits & phone calls
- In-home respite care
- Activities especially for people with dementia or cognitive decline
- Social and shopping bus trips
- Information, advocacy & referral
- Individual transport to appointments
- Helping with forms, bills, banking, shopping
- Pet care
